About the Artist

Steel Panther burst onto the scene, seemingly out of nowhere, with a mission to revive and satirise the very essence of the glam metal era. Comprising Michael Starr (vocals), Satchel (guitars), Lexxi Foxx (bass), and Stix Zadinia (drums), this Los Angeles-based quartet have perfected the art of the parody. Their music, while hilariously mimicking the sound and style of bands like Mรถtley Crรผe, Poison, and Bon Jovi, is surprisingly well-crafted and genuinely rocking. Each member embodies their over-the-top persona with aplomb, from Starr's soaring, often ludicrous, vocals to Satchel's shredding guitar solos that are both impressive and comical. Lexxi Foxx's flamboyant basslines and Stix Zadinia's thunderous drumming provide the solid, albeit often tongue-in-cheek, foundation for their sonic assault. Their lyrics are a masterclass in comedic songwriting, celebrating and lampooning the hedonistic lifestyle of rock gods โ€“ think fast cars, copious amounts of drugs, and an endless parade of groupies, all delivered with a swagger that's both infectious and absurd. They've released several successful albums, including "Feel the Steel", "Balls Out", and "Lower the Bar", each packed with anthems that have become staples of their live shows.

The Venue

The O2 Forum Kentish Town is a historic and beloved live music venue located in the heart of North London. With a capacity that strikes a perfect balance between intimate and grand, it has played host to countless legendary artists across a multitude of genres. Its iconic Art Deco facade and atmospheric interior provide the perfect backdrop for a night of high-octane rock and roll. Known for its excellent acoustics and vibrant atmosphere, the O2 Forum Kentish Town ensures that every note, every scream, and every power chord will resonate through the crowd. Its central location makes it easily accessible, and its reputation for hosting top-tier rock and metal acts means you're in for a proper treat.
